Are you in the airline industry or thinking about entering it? Then you know that you will have to memorize the 3-digit IATA (International Air Transport Association) and possibly 4-digit ICAO (International Civil Aviation Organization) airport codes. These are the codes that represent an airport. Use this app to memorize the IATA/ICAO airport codes, names of the airports and where they are located.

So you think you know these?
- Where is MCO? That's Orlando International Airport but what does the MCO stand for? It is McCoy Orlando because it used to be McCoy air force base.

- Did you know that most US airports have a 3-digit code like COD but their 4-digit code just uses a K in front of it like KCOD? It's easy to go between them.

- Did you know that some airports have completely different codes like FCA and KGPI for Kallispell, Montana, USA? This is tough to know.

- What about the names of the airports themselves? When someone wants to go to JFK airport, then you need to know the code.
